Transaction 58c105e30ba5b073dcc3e12a8ba2d846dea70e9e5e8d87d602dee1a3b4b51ad7

1 Input
1 Outputs
  • 58c105e30ba5b073dcc3e12a8ba2d846dea70e9e5e8d87d602dee1a3b4b51ad7:0
  • value  13986902
    address  3EvsL1VWjb62gfqhCnycTeSyTGvn1rfNew